Rediscovering the Wonder: Why Cabinets of Curiosities Are Captivating Collectors Again



There was a time when collectors really did not simply acquire to have-- they curated their collections as tales. Lengthy prior to minimal interiors and digital galleries, the "cupboard of curiosities" was the supreme expression of interest, taste, and intellect. Additionally called wunderkammern, these cabinets were much less regarding storage space and more about spectacle-- elaborate display screens filled with uncommon minerals, preserved pests, tribal artifacts, scientific marvels, and creative treasures. They were a statement of expertise and marvel.



Fast-forward to today, and something fascinating is happening. The cabinet of curiosities is making a silent yet striking resurgence. In an age saturated with digital content, there's an expanding hunger for the tangible, the unique, and the fabled. Modern collection agencies are restoring the spirit of these cabinets-- not simply in the actual sense yet in exactly how they approach gathering: with thoughtfulness, intentionality, and an interest for the unusual.
